So finally I recorded the hurling match after a lot of procrastinating, the match was between Kilkenny and Tipperary- two bordering counties. I had a great time and the sound from it turned out great! The sound of the crowd had a tendency to rise and fall when excited by something happening, this sounded really gutteral and primal almost as if they were all so engrossed by what was going on they couldn't control the noise that came from them. I decided to focus in on this and use it to give people the experience of being there of the sound of the excitement causing this deep feeling of excitement, of slight anxiety maybe? I was using the sound for a multimedia project and cut and pasted all the rising and falling sounds of the crowd together then did a little bit more editing. Now i'm using it for my class exhibiton which is on tomorrow in this cool place called Stix in Limerick!
